Our Bottom Line Questions

✤ Has our use of innovative technologies and social media actually improved language learning? And if so, in what ways?

✤ Do students learn foreign languages better today than what they used to? And if so, how does the implementation of innovative technologies and social media play a role in this progress?

✤ When we say that learners are using innovative technologies and social media in language learning, what are they really doing?

Starting Premise 3: Development in Foreign Language Acquisition

✤ In the past 40 years we have witnessed an accelerated development in theories related to language acquisition. Almost all of these theories include components that look at real communication, social interactions, affective factors, and negotiation of meaning.

✤ Among the language acquisition theories that correlate well with the use of technology, cognitive and social constructivism stand out.

✤ E.g., Dewey, 1933; Piaget, 1972; Vygotsky, 1978; Jonassen, Peck & Wilson, 1990; Bruner, 1990; Fosnot, 2005; Koohang, Riley, Smith & Schreurs, 2009; Overbaya, Patterson, Vasua & Grablec, 2010.

Cognitive and Social Constructivism in General

✤ Knowledge is something that is constructed within a social context

✤ People in a community help each other out by lending support, interacting with one another, serving as shadow guides, and building on each other’s progress.

✤ Progress is always collaborative

Cognitive and Social Constructivism in Language Learning

✤ Language learning is not simply a matter of memorization of vocabulary, pronunciation, grammar, and syntax.

✤ Language learning is a matter of putting learners in an active situation where people construct meaning within a social context.
